PM Narendra Modi tops list of most popular world leaders with 78% rating: Survey

New Delhi: According to the latest survey by Morning Consult,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i has emerged as the most popular global leader, leaving behind other popular leaders like Joe Biden, Rishi Sunak, etc. from 22 countries. The said survey was conducted by ‘Morning Consult’ between 26 January to 31 January.

According to the survey list, PM Modi topped with a popularity approval rating of 78%. He was then followed by Mexico’s President Lopez Obrador with an approval rating of 68%. Australia’s PM Anthony Albanese ranked third with a rating of 58% in popularity.

Morning Consult conducts over 20,000 global interviews per day. The data created about the global leader is prepared on the basis of the answers received in the interview. Its sample size in America is 45,000 thousand. On the other hand, the sample size of other countries is between 500 to 5000. Surveys are weighted in each country on the basis of age, gender, region and in some countries education. In the US, surveys are also done on the basis of race and ethnicity.
